Software Updates

Apple's iOS 27 update will introduce a revamped AirPods settings menu within the Settings app, alongside a dedicated Siri app and upgraded Camera interface according to multiple reports. The update is expected to launch next month with improved heart-rate tracking in watch OS, though the company's AI health coach Project Mulberry may delay beyond the initial release. Apple is also preparing a new Gen AI website ahead of WWDC, while accessibility features will focus on expanded capabilities for vision-impaired users including enhanced Voice Control and Sound Recognition tools.

Artificial Intelligence

Apple's Image Playground feature will receive significant improvements in the OS 27 cycle, addressing criticism around AI avatar generation quality. The company's Apple Intelligence image models are expected to include major visual upgrades, though Apple's overall AI spending remains flat compared to competitors who lose $1.25 for every dollar spent. iOS 27 will add Google Cast support as required by EU Digital Markets Act compliance, allowing non-Air Play streaming protocols on iPhone devices. Apple Intelligence 2.0 promises expanded capabilities that could address user complaints about underwhelming current implementations.

Market Position

Apple captured the global smartphone market lead in Q1 2026 for the first time ever, according to Counterpoint Research data, surpassing Samsung and Xiaomi in worldwide shipments. Unionized Apple Store employees plan a May 27 protest at the Towson Town Center location over working conditions and store closure decisions. Google appealed its 2024 antitrust ruling claiming Apple selected its search engine "fair and square," while Meta launched Forum, a standalone Facebook Groups app for iOS users seeking community-focused social networking alternatives.
